I recently bought a 1925 Dodge Brothers special roadster. It has been sitting since about 1949. I think it was used as a truck before it was parked. The top and the trunk deck or rumble seat is missing.

The spare tire and wheel is mounted behind the left front fender. There is a cam-locking mechanism and a hook on each side about 12 inches behind the doors. Just behind the doors is a vertical plate with a row of bolts on each side that attaches the rear body to the cab. The attaching plate looks factory original to the car. I have found a few pictures of a 1925 and none of them have these features.

Any information about this car would be greatly appreciated.
